WordPress is a free, open-source content management system (CMS) that makes it easy to create and manage a website without needing to know how to code.

WordPress can be used to build almost any type of website, including blogs, business websites, portfolios, news sites, online stores, and more. It includes an easy-to-use dashboard where you can create pages, publish posts, upload images and videos, and manage your website's content.

One of the biggest advantages of WordPress is how customizable it is. Thousands of themes are available to change the design and appearance of your website, while plugins can add features such as contact forms, photo galleries, online stores, security tools, SEO features, and much more.

WordPress can also grow with your website. Beginners can build a site using themes and visual page builders, while more advanced users and developers can customize WordPress with their own code.

WordPress was first released in 2003 and has grown into the world's most widely used website content management system.
